Output 7bacf0e246bfac8fbe1ae2b160f3317b7e13b2f99bafeab137988421caa894d0:6

value
42160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e918242fcbdff1898b1ce98d704a605e07fffd73 OP_EQUAL
address
3NwWHcPUVMMEa6p5nBFQn7nEEuu3fccJdf
transaction
7bacf0e246bfac8fbe1ae2b160f3317b7e13b2f99bafeab137988421caa894d0
confirmations
515043
spent
true